    @Westcoastmaven@mastodon.social @davidho@mastodon.world possibly overstated. Whilst there is some risk. British heart foundation have this to say: “Induction hobs do generate electromagnetic fields, so keep a distance of at least 60cm (2ft) between the stovetop and your pacemaker. Most people should be able to use a hob if they follow these precautions, but if you are choosing a new cooker, it may be easier to pick one that is not an induction hob.” There remain electric options that, whilst maybe a bit slower than induction, are still perfectly good and better than gas.
